What I read... Exodus 36.

This passage just astounds me... v.6-7

Then Moses gave an order and they sent this word throughout the camp: "No man or woman is to make anything else as an offering for the sanctuary." And so the people were restrained from bringing more, because what they already had was more than enough to do all the work.

I love that they just kept bringing more and more to the Lord, everything never seems enough for the Lord, he deserves are everything and yet we still withhold so much from him. I love that they brought an abundance to him. I love that they were overwhelmed by the vast amount of offering that they had to say that's enough. Why can't we be more like them. Bringing more and more to the Lord, for all the great he has done in our lives, it is a wonder we do not offer it all to him. Yet people still desire money and more money. Oh the world we live in. Money I do not have much of, years I do not have much of, possessions I have more than others, but I still do not have much of. Time I wish I had more of and myself I wish I had more of to give to him. I know that my offering is small and probably minuscule compared to what some can give. However, I do believe the Lord can still do a lot with everything that I give. I may not give tons of money, but time and love I can give in abundance. Truly all the Lord really wants from me, is me as a living sacrifice for him to do with what he has planned for my life.

All of Him is all I will ever need, all of me is all he has ever asked for.

I think that is a valid trade. I hope to serve him well and be a blessing in his service.
